Thank you for contacting us! If you opt for a custom doll, we will arrange for it to be manufactured in the factory, and then inspected, packed, and shipped to you. We ship directly from Hong Kong to the United States by plane, where we assist with customs clearance, so generally, you don’t need to do anything but wait. After clearing customs, we will have a local courier service, like FedEx or UPS, deliver to your address. This is why the official website may only show "label created" before customs clearance is completed; the package is already on its way to the US.

If you choose from our stock, these dolls are shipped by sea to the US and then stored in our warehouse in California. This is why it generally takes longer to update the quantity and availability of dolls in our overseas warehouse since sea transportation can take over a month before the dolls are available for sale. But don’t worry, because the inventory dolls listed on our website are already in our US warehouse, delivery generally takes just a few days. For customers in California, it’s even quicker, typically taking 2-3 days to receive your order, which is very fast.
